How Wrestling Builds Discipline and Resilience in Students

Despite the widespread belief that wrestling is merely a physically demanding sport, there are various advantages that reach far beyond the mat. Wrestling teaches teenagers perseverance and discipline, all of which are necessary for academic achievement and personal development. This article examines the ways in which different facets of training and competition in wrestling impart these essential life skills.

Developing Mental Toughness Through Wrestling

Mental toughness is one of the most important qualities that wrestling fosters. The sport requires a great deal of concentration, strategic thinking, and situational flexibility. Wrestlers need to develop the ability to remain composed under duress, whether it be during a competition or when juggling demanding training and academic obligations.

A study conducted by the Positive Psychology Center at the University of Pennsylvania highlighted the positive impact of youth sports, including wrestling, on psychological well-being. Young people's resilience, emotional health, and self-esteem can all be enhanced by sports. Children who participate in wrestling develop mental toughness, which is essential for success in both academic and physical pursuits. Building Self-Discipline in Student Athletes

Wrestling athletes must adhere to stringent diets and training regimens. This dedication teaches children about the importance of self-control and tenacity in reaching their goals. Wrestlers develop exceptional time management abilities as they learn to reconcile their training schedules with their academic responsibilities.

Wrestlers may need to drop weight before competing in certain weight classes. This therapy requires a high level of self-control since patients must stick to rigid exercise regimes and watch their food intake. Student-athletes can enhance their academic performance and study habits by focusing on time management and prioritizing. Overcoming Challenges in Wrestling Training

Overcoming obstacles is a fundamental aspect of wrestling. During preparation and competition, athletes experience emotional setbacks, mental depletion, and physical exhaustion. Every setback or challenging practice session presents a chance for improvement. Adversity is embraced by wrestlers as a way to develop resilience.

According to child psychologist and youth wrestling fan Chris Mance, wrestling helps kids develop a "internal locus of control," or the knowledge that success comes from hard work. Students that adopt this thought system are better able to view difficulties as opportunities rather than barriers. Students who get instruction in this area are more likely to endure and overcome obstacles, whether in wrestling or academics. Life Lessons Acquired thru Wrestling

In addition to their physical ability, wrestling imparts important life skills to students:

  • Establishing Objectives: Wrestlers establish clear objectives for their level of skill development, fitness, and competitive performance. A growth attitude that promotes ongoing development is ingrained by this practice.

  • Accountability: Wrestlers learn to take responsibility for their actions, whether celebrating victories or reflecting on losses. This accountability fosters humility and resilience.

  • Teamwork: Although wrestling is an individual sport, many wrestlers train in teams where they learn the value of collaboration and support from peers.

  • Emotional Management: The sport teaches athletes how to manage emotions after losses or setbacks, a skill that is critical for resilience in all areas of life.

Physical and Emotional Resilience in Sports

Wrestling not only builds physical strength but also enhances emotional resilience. Athletes must endure discomfort and exhaustion due to the demanding nature of the sport. Regularly participating in such rigorous training sessions helps wrestlers build a strong work ethic that they may use to tackle scholastic problems.

The connection between physical activity and academic performance has been supported by various studies. Children who play sports like wrestling typically have higher GPAs than their classmates who don't play sports, according to study. Children that participate in wrestling learn discipline, which helps them stay motivated and engaged in their studies and improves their academic performance.

Notable Figures Advocating for Wrestling

Prominent individuals have recognized the transformative power of wrestling in fostering resilience in youth. Olympic champion Jordan Burroughs has often talked about how his wrestling background influenced his outlook and work ethic. Burroughs highlights the lifelong skills of self-control, toughness, and perseverance that are acquired on the mat.

Furthermore, organizations such as Beat the Streets have used wrestling's impact to mentor and support poor teenagers. In addition to teaching wrestling techniques, these programs emphasize participants' self-control and tenacity.
